Founder-led X/Twitter launch playbook
Use this when the product can be explained through a concrete pain, a before/after transformation, or a credible build-in-public story.
Audience
Indie founders using founder-led distribution for SaaS, templates, or paid digests
Validation metric
Profile clicks, reply quality, bookmark/save intent, waitlist signups, and repeated requests for examples.
Launch steps
- Open with the painful before state your target founder already recognizes.
- Show the after state as a repeatable habit, report, template, or workflow.
- Add one proof point: teardown source, small result, screenshot, or constraint.
- Give away one reusable hook or prompt in the post body.
- End with a low-friction CTA to get weekly examples or join the waitlist.
- Turn replies and objections into the next three SEO pages.
Pitfalls to avoid
- Do not make the thread about your features before the reader feels the pain.
- Avoid inflated revenue claims unless you can show real evidence.
- Do not optimize for likes only; prioritize replies from people who match the buyer profile.
